Not working automatic update for Joomla is a common problem, and it is hosting/server related issue. Probably your hosting is blocking external connection for security reasons (an external connection is required to checking/updating).
But there is an easy way for that; browse this page:
joomlacode.org/gf/project/joomla/frs/?action=index
and downlaod this update file:
Joomla_2.5.x_to_2.5.14-Stable-Patch_Package.zip
Then install that ZIP file through "Joomla Extensions Manager" as if you are installing an ordinary module/plugin to your joomla. Then you will get 2.5.14 which is the latest stable version of joomla 2.5.xx as of now.
About automatic updating Virtuemart, even your server did let external connection, it wouldn't work, because Virtuemart stop supporting automatic update.
They have notified this already:
Just use hte normal installation routine provided by joomla. Also you should disable for a clean installation the akeeba installer in case you use it. We are sorry, but we had not the time yet to replace the liveupdater with a better system.
so, go to
www.virtuemart.net, download the most recent virtuemart versions and install it through "Joomla Extension Manager".
